Instructions

Chapter 2 Command System RIGOL
MSO5000-E Programming Guide 2-143
Parameter
Name
Type
Range
Default
[<n>]
Discrete
{1}
1
<freq> Real
Sine: 0.1 Hz to 25 MHz
Square: 0.1 Hz to 15 MHz
Pulse: 0.1 Hz to 1 MHz
Ramp: 0.1 Hz to 100 kHz
Arb: 0.1 Hz to 10 MHz
1 kHz
<amp> Real
Related to the currently
set output impedance
HighZ: 20 mVpp to 5 Vpp
50Ω: 10 mVpp to 2.5 Vpp
5 Vpp
<offset> Real
Related to the current
output impedance and
amplitude
HighZ: (-2.5V + current
amplitude/2) to (2.5V -
current amplitude/2)
50Ω: (-1.25V + current
amplitude/2) to (1.25V -
current amplitude/2)
0 V
DC
<phase>
Real
0° to 360°
Remarks This series of commands are used to select the waveform shape.
NOISe: noise
PULSe: pulse
RAMP: ramp waveform
SINusoid: sine waveform
SQUare: square waveform
ARBitrary: arbitrary waveform
<freq>: sets the frequency of the specified waveform (this parameter is not
available for Noise waveform). By default, the unit is Hz.
<amp>: sets the amplitude of the specified waveform. By default, the unit is
Vpp.
<offset>: sets the DC offset of the specified waveform. By default, the unit is
V
DC
.
<phase>: sets the start phase of the specified waveform (this parameter is not
available for Noise waveform). By default, the unit is degree (°).
This series of commands allow users to omit one or multiple parameters. When
all the parameters are omitted, the commands only configure the specified
function/arbitrary waveform generator channel to the specified waveform,
without modifying the corresponding parameters.
The four parameters <freq>, <amp>, <offset>, and <phase> should be
appeared in sequence. In the command, the parameters are configured in
sequence, and you are not allowed to set the latter parameter without setting
the former one. For example, you cannot set the parameter <amp> directly by
omitting the parameter <freq>.